School Overview
Berenece Carlson Home Hospital (CHIPAH) is a specialized educational facility within the Los Angeles Unified School District (LAUSD) designed to serve students who are unable to attend a traditional school campus due to medical or psychiatric conditions. Unlike a conventional school, CHIPAH functions as an itinerant or short-term program that provides instructional continuity for students facing health crises. Its primary goal is to ensure that students remain on track academically while managing their recovery or health challenges, preventing them from falling behind in their grade-level requirements.
The program utilizes a flexible approach to education, often coordinating with the student’s home school to maintain curriculum alignment. Teachers associated with the program provide instruction that accommodates the specific physical or emotional limitations of the student, whether through hospital-based learning or home-based services. By offering this specialized support, Berenece Carlson Home Hospital serves as a vital bridge, allowing students to maintain a connection to their education and peer community during periods of significant medical transition.
